What is the Telc B1 Qualification?
The Telc B1 credentials belongs to the Telc B1-Prüfungsgebühr GmbH system, which provides language efficiency tests in numerous languages, including German. The B1 level of the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R) is characterized as an intermediate level where prospects can comprehend and communicate in life situations.

The Authentischer Telc B1-Anbieter B1 examination assesses four necessary language skills: reading, writing, listening, and speaking. Each component is developed to determine the candidate's proficiency in a useful context.
Examination StructureElementDurationFormatScoreReading50 minutesNumerous option & & fill-in-the-blank0-25Composing45 minutesBrief writing tasks0-25Listening30 minutesAudio-based concerns0-25Speaking15 minutesFace-to-face interview0-25Overall--0-100Scoring System
To pass the Telc B1 examination, prospects need to accomplish a minimum score of 60%. Provided that the overall rating quantities to 100, this implies candidates must go for a minimum of 60 points overall.

The length of time is the Telc B1 certification valid?
The Telc B1 credentials does not have an expiration date, indicating it stays valid indefinitely as soon as you pass the evaluation.
2. Where can I take the Telc B1 exam?
Telc B1 online Erwerben B1 exams are offered in various places, including language schools, universities, and accredited testing centers throughout Germany and other nations.
3. What is the cost of taking the Telc B1 examination?
The cost of the Telc B1 exam varies by area and screening center, generally ranging from EUR150 to EUR200.
4. Can I retake the Telc B1 test if I do not pass?
Yes, candidates can retake the Telc B1 exam as lots of times as essential. Nevertheless, they will need to pay the examination fee each time.
5. How quickly will I get my results?
Results are generally available around four to six weeks after the examination date.
